Output 3990ffafcb0a2f54446c62e2e54ec37068e7131043bd57e1818cd0d55e1d4666:1

value
19694422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0aed90b9928a138bbdc63f155f7897f1e4fa33 OP_EQUAL
address
3L7KWaoEWHYk2uoPHajUaYNK765SSEn2vW
transaction
3990ffafcb0a2f54446c62e2e54ec37068e7131043bd57e1818cd0d55e1d4666
spent
true